Transaction 144b32bd7a1985bf3f838d6b7eea0e924d95eb80a807354bcfdad63f7f729453

1 Input
2 Outputs
  • 144b32bd7a1985bf3f838d6b7eea0e924d95eb80a807354bcfdad63f7f729453:0
  • value  2001761
    address  1E4gpHCSFe8dHx9ig4nRaBmevXS83a7atK
  • 144b32bd7a1985bf3f838d6b7eea0e924d95eb80a807354bcfdad63f7f729453:1
  • value  23960000
    address  3J8E7ZnSgNkAR3PUn3oh7J29zcAPovXHkJ